23 Days Suspension for Jannes Labuschagne,

At a disciplinary hearing held on Tuesday 26 November 2002 by video link between Heathrow Airport, London and Ellis Park, Johannesburg, the following decisions were reached covering two incidents from the England v South Africa match on 23 November at Twickenham.

In the case of Jannes Labuschagne, who received a red card for a late challenge on Jonny Wilkinson, the Committee decided to apply a suspension of 23 days commencing at the start of the Super 12 season (21 February 2003).

In the case of Werner Greef, who was cited for a high tackle on Phil Christophers, having considered the reports of the Citing Commissioner and officials, the Committee decided not to overturn the refereeā€™s judgement that a yellow or red card should not be shown and, therefore, did not impose any sanction.

The disciplinary Committee was chaired by Neil Bidder, QC, from Wales, and also included Douglas Hunter from Scotland, and Brian McLoughlin from Ireland.
